Description
C-17 TRAINING SYSTEM (TS) INDUSTRY DAY ANNOUNCEMENT: The overall C-17 TS Sustainment contract will provide aircrew instruction (ATS only), courseware, Aircrew Training System (ATS) & Maintenance Training System (MTS) Contractor Logistics Support (CLS), concurrency and obsolescence modifications, and training flights to produce certified aircrew members. For additional details about the C-17 TS Program see notice C17TS-SSS-19-0001, Sources Sought Synopsis, C-17 Training System Contractor Logistics Support, Archived 9 October 2019. The C-17 Training System (TS) Program will be conducting an industry day at the annual Interservice/ Industry Training, Simulation and Education Conference (I/ITSEC) in Orlando, FL, during the week of 2 December 2019. For more information about I/ITSEC, please visit https://www.iitsec.org. The C-17 TS has scheduled an Industry Day presentation for Wednesday, 4 December 2019, from 4:00 - 5:00 PM Eastern Standard Time (EST), in Conference Room S230C. Following the Wednesday Industry Day presentation, one-on-one meetings with interested firms will be held on Thursday, 5 December 2019, from 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M EST, with a break from noon to 1:00 PM for lunch. The specific location of the one-on-one sessions is TBD, but is expected to be in a 20 x 20 conference room on the convention floor. These sessions will be held between the Government and interested firms that has requested a meeting in response to this notice on a first come, first served basis. Interested firms will be allotted 55 minutes (starting every hour on the hour) for discussion and questions. Due to limitations on space, attendance at one-on-one meeting sessions will be limited to no more than three (3) representatives of an interested firm. To secure a time slot for a one-on-one session, please respond to this notice not later than Tuesday, 5 November 2019, by emailing your requested time slot to AFLCMC.WNS.RFI_RESPONSE@us.af.mil. Interested firms requesting a one-on-one session should submit questions and discussion points in advance of industry day, to the e-mail address above, no later than Friday, 15 November 2019.
